Most states have a statute of limitations, or time period, within which individuals have to take legal action to receive compensation for mesothelioma. The length of time varies from state to state, but the majority of mesothelioma lawsuits have to be filed within one to three years of diagnosis.

They charge contingency fees

Most mesothelioma lawyers operate on a contingency fee. This means they will only be paid if and when they receive compensation for their client. This is an excellent benefit for mesothelioma patients as it ensures they do not need to pay a fee upfront to obtain a lawyer's services.

But, it is important to inquire about the fees charged by an attorney prior to hiring one. A lot of attorneys charge an hourly rate, which can quickly become costly in the event of a case going to court. Some firms also advertise that they have extensive experience handling mesothelioma cases but do not actually take the cases themselves. They instead transfer the case to another firm and pay part of the attorney's fee in exchange for helping the victim sign up with the mesothelioma law firm.

On average, mesothelioma victims receive between $1 million and $1.4 million in compensation. A jury verdict could result in more substantial awards.

Mesothelioma lawsuits can also help veterans obtain compensation through the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). People diagnosed with mesothelioma might be eligible for monthly financial aid and low-cost or free medical treatment. Attorneys can assist veterans in deciding the trust fund they should be using to file their claims. They can also file VA claim forms on behalf of the veteran.
